  Ecological, social, and intrinsic factors affecting wild orangutans' curiosity, assessed using a field experiment

Schuppli, C., Nellissen, L., Carvajal, L., Ashbury, A. M., Oliver-Caldwell, N., Rahmaeti, T., et al. (2023). Ecological, social, and intrinsic factors affecting wild orangutans' curiosity, assessed using a field experiment. Scientific Reports, 13(1): 13184. doi:10.1038/s41598-023-39214-2.
